To use the
]
Start button with a network scanner, the client
computer must start both the host application and EPSON
TWAIN Pro Network. Pressing the
]
Start button sends the
scanned image to the client computer currently connected to
the scanner server, but does not automatically launch any
applications.
When EPSON Scan Server is running, the Expression 1640XL
connected to the scanner server becomes a network scanner
available only to remote users. The scanner server cannot use
the
]
Start button features described in this chapter, which
are only available to a local scanner.
